Key Financial Indicators and Performance Metrics

To gauge Zscaler’s financial health, it’s essential to analyze several key performance indicators (KPIs). These metrics not only highlight the company’s growth potential but also reflect how well it is executing its strategic goals. Some of the most critical KPIs for Zscaler include:

  • Revenue Growth: Zscaler has consistently reported impressive year-over-year revenue growth, a testament to its robust business model and the increasing adoption of cloud services.
  • Gross Margin: With the high-margin nature of its software-as-a-service (SaaS) offerings, Zscaler enjoys a strong gross margin, which is crucial for reinvestment into research and development.
  • Customer Acquisition Cost (CAC): Monitoring CAC helps Zscaler evaluate the efficiency of its marketing and sales strategies, ensuring that customer growth is sustainable.
  • Net Retention Rate: A high net retention rate indicates that Zscaler not only retains customers but also expands its relationship with existing clients, further solidifying its market position.
